1、url重定向是什么意思

URL重定向是指将网页的URL地址从一个位置重定向到另一个位置。当用户在浏览器中输入或点击一个链接,请求访问某个网页时,服务器会根据网页的URL来返回相应的内容。然而,在某些情况下,网站可能需要将某个URL重新定向到其他URL,这就是URL重定向的作用。

URL重定向有很多使用场景。一种常见的情况是网站更改了某个网页的URL地址,但为了保持用户访问的连续性,网站会将旧的URL重定向到新的URL。这样,当用户访问旧的URL时,服务器会自动将请求重定向到新的URL上,保证用户不会遇到404错误页面。

另外,URL重定向还可以用于跳转到不同的网页版本。例如,当网站有多个语言版本或移动版和桌面版时,服务器可以根据用户的设备或语言偏好将请求重定向到相应的网页版本。这样,用户可以访问到最适合他们的内容。

URL重定向是通过特殊的HTTP状态码来实现的。最常用的状态码是301重定向和302临时重定向。301重定向是永久性重定向,告诉搜索引擎和浏览器该URL已被永久移动到新的位置,搜索引擎会更新索引,浏览器会自动记住新的URL。而302临时重定向则表示该URL暂时重定向到其他位置,搜索引擎会保存原有URL,浏览器不会自动记住新的URL。

URL重定向是网站管理者用来调整网页URL地址,并保持用户访问连续性的重要手段。通过重定向,网站可以更好地管理网页的访问和内容呈现,提供更好的用户体验。

url重定向是什么意思(redirecturl请求重定向)-风君雪科技博客

2、redirecturl请求重定向

redirecturl请求重定向是一种常见的网络技术,它允许我们在浏览器请求一个URL时,自动跳转到另一个URL。这个技术在网页开发和网络应用中非常有用,可以帮助我们实现更好的用户体验和优化网站结构。

当我们在浏览器输入一个URL时,服务器就会接收到这个请求,并根据URL找到对应的网页或资源返回给浏览器。然而,在某些情况下,我们希望用户请求一个URL时,自动跳转到另一个URL,这时就可以使用redirecturl请求重定向技术。

重定向可以用于多种情况,比如网站的页面重定向,将用户从一个URL自动跳转到另一个URL;网站的域名重定向,将用户从一个域名跳转到另一个域名;还可以用于处理表单提交后的重定向,将用户提交的数据处理后跳转到另一个页面或显示结果。

在重定向过程中,服务器会向浏览器返回一个特殊的HTTP状态码,通常是301或302。301状态码表示永久重定向,说明请求的URL已永久转移到新的URL上;302状态码表示临时重定向,说明请求的URL临时转移到新的URL上。

除了HTTP状态码外,服务器还会返回一个Location头部字段,其中包含了要重定向到的URL。浏览器在接收到这个响应后,会自动跳转到新的URL,从而完成重定向过程。

redirecturl请求重定向是一种强大的网络技术,可以帮助我们实现网站页面的跳转、域名的切换和处理表单提交等功能。它能够提升用户体验、优化网站结构,并且非常易于实现。因此,在网页开发中,我们应该充分利用redirecturl请求重定向,以提升网站的功能性和用户友好度。

url重定向是什么意思(redirecturl请求重定向)-风君雪科技博客

3、网页中header是什么意思

在网页设计中,header(头部)是指页面顶部的区域,通常包含网站的标志、导航菜单、搜索框以及其他重要的信息。它是网页的重要组成部分,能够帮助用户快速了解并导航网站的内容。

header中最重要的元素之一是网站的标志。标志通常位于页面的左上角,通过图标或文字展示网站的名称或品牌。标志的出现可以让用户迅速识别当前所在的网站,增强品牌识别度。

导航菜单也经常出现在header中。导航菜单是网页中的主要导航控件,通常以水平或垂直的形式展示在页面顶部。它可以包含网站的各个主要页面链接,帮助用户快速导航到所需页面。导航菜单的设计需要简洁明了,以提供良好的用户体验。

此外,一些网页还会在header中放置搜索框。搜索框可以帮助用户快速找到他们想要的信息,提高用户满意度和效率。搜索框通常附带搜索按钮,用于提交搜索请求。

除了上述元素,header中还可以包含其他重要的信息,例如联系方式、语言选择等。这些信息可以方便用户查找和使用网站提供的额外服务。

网页中的header是用户第一眼接触到的区域,能够为用户提供基本的导航功能和网站标识。它的设计应简洁明了,符合用户习惯,并且能够快速引导用户到达所需页面。一个好的header能够提高用户的使用体验,提升网站的可用性和吸引力。

url重定向是什么意思(redirecturl请求重定向)-风君雪科技博客

4、iptables域名重定向

iptables域名重定向是一种网络安全技术,用于在Linux系统上控制网络流量和实现域名重定向。通过使用iptables命令,我们可以配置防火墙规则,将流量从一个域名重定向到另一个域名或IP地址。

域名重定向可以用于多种目的。例如,我们可以将特定的域名或IP地址重定向到一个备份服务器,以实现网站故障转移和容错。这样,当主服务器发生故障时,流量会自动重定向到备份服务器,确保网站的可用性。

另外,域名重定向也可以用于网络安全目的。通过将恶意域名重定向到一个安全网站,我们可以阻止用户访问可能包含恶意软件或欺诈行为的网站,从而提高系统的安全性。

要配置iptables域名重定向,我们可以使用如下命令:

“`sh

iptables -t nat -I PREROUTING -d www.example.com -j DNAT –to-destination 192.168.1.2

“`

这条命令意味着将所有目标地址为”www.example.com”的流量重定向到IP地址为192.168.1.2的主机。

需要注意的是,为了使iptables域名重定向生效,我们还需要启用网络地址转换(NAT)功能,通过以下命令来启用:

“`sh

echo 1 > /proc/sys/net/ipv4/ip_forward

“`

这个命令将启用IP转发,使得Linux系统可以将流量转发到不同的目标地址。

总结而言,iptables域名重定向是一项强大的网络安全技术。通过配置防火墙规则,我们可以将流量从一个域名重定向到另一个域名或IP地址,实现网站故障转移、容错和网络安全等目的。使用iptables命令可以轻松地实现这个功能,提高系统的可用性和安全性。